In 7 days is the Get in the Show finale event for Adventures in Odyssey. A huge thank you to Katie Leigh - Voice Actor, for taking the time for this. 🙌🏻. She wanted to share her thoughts on the finale event with YOU! 

Here's what she had to say in response to my questions: 

1. What are you most looking forward to about this Event and why? 

I am looking forward to working/performing with he contestants and meeting their families as well the people coming out for the contest. I love meeting the fans.

2. If there was 1 thing you could tell people as to why they should/would want to be a part of this event, what would you say to them?

I would say, these kids are working hard trying to impress and win your vote. Please watch and support your favorite contestant. Also, it will determine who they will actually listen to on an upcoming AIO episode. Go to https://streaming.whitsend.org/ for more info! *event is August 12th!
